Shigakogen Open Season 2022 Our neighbours have started skiing in Shiga Kogen! Yokoteyama the highest ski resort in the area at nearby Shiga Kogen has officially opened on the 18th of November. The bottom of the resort is at 1750m above Sea Level and the top at a lofty 2305m so they tend to get more snow and colder temps in the early part of the season. Conditions are still marginal and looks like they have been using the Snow guns to make some extra snow but that fall last week was enough to give it the green light. Snow Depth Nozawa Onsen It is amazing what snow depth we get to in Nozawa Onsen Ski Resort in Japan Keep your eye on the road signs in Nozawa The below shot is after the first snowfall of the season a few days ago with about 15cm falling from reports. The above shot is peak season after about 12 meters of snow falling in total. The peak base last year up top was 480cm on the 23rd of February 2022. So that sign sits at about 5 meters above ground level. That’s the equivalent of almost 3 grown adults standing on each others shoulders. Courier Service Nozawa Japan The Journey is inevitable. Baggage is optional Have lots of people contacting us asking if can send their bags up to Nozawa when arrive. The Answer is yes! The Courier service mainly handled by a company known as Black Cat or “Kuro Neko” is next level. They will get your bag from A to B in Japan in no time and at a very reasonable cost with pure Japanese efficiency. I once sent a bag from Tokyo at 7pm and it arrived in Nozawa at 9am the next morning. I would have struggled to get it there any quicker myself! It only cost 1500 yen too. Accommodation Nozawa Fire Festival The Nozawa Onsen Fire Festival Who has seen it? Let us know what you thought it was like. The Fire Festival is a spectacle which needs to be seen to be believed. It is held on January 15th every year to pray for a plentiful harvest, health and good fortune in the coming year. The festival dates back to 1863, and has a rich and colourful history in Nozawa Onsen. During this festival the twenty-five and forty-two year old men from the village play a very important role. Early Bird Special Nozawa First “Magic Foot” of Snow for the Alps Up at the peak of Hotakadake mountain, the third highest mountain in Japan at 3190m above sea level they got close to 30cm of snow just yesterday! The report says there was nothing in the morning but it snowed all day and almost a foot accumulated on the doorstep of the mountain hut there. The hut is set up for Mountain climbers to stay in over the green season and it’s open for just 2 more days before going into hibernation for the Winter. Nozawa Onsen Main Street Main Street Nozawa Onsen Oyu dori The Main Street in Nozawa is pretty special to walk down anytime of year. Most nights between May and November it is like the empty shot and you could throw a bowling ball down the street but not hit a soul. In peak holiday times and most of winter though it comes to life however and the streets are bustling with people coming back from skiing and heading to an Onsen or for a bite to eat.
